What Are Customized Healthcare Software Solutions?

Customized healthcare software solutions are digital systems created specifically for a healthcare organization’s unique needs.

These solutions are not pre-built products. They are designed after understanding how doctors, nurses, administrators, and support staff work every day. The software is shaped around real processes, making it easier to use and more effective.

The goal is simple: make daily healthcare work smoother, faster, and more reliable.

Why One-Size-Fits-All Software Often Fails

Many healthcare providers start with ready-made software because it seems quick and affordable. While this can work at first, problems usually appear over time.

Standard software often includes features that are not needed and lacks features that are essential. Staff may need to follow awkward steps just to complete simple tasks. This increases frustration, slows down work, and can even lead to errors.

Customized healthcare software solutions avoid these issues by focusing only on what truly matters for the organization.
